What to Look for When Hiring an Electrician in Hastings
Not all electricians are created equal. Here's what you should keep an eye out for when choosing someone for your job:
- Current licensing — Every electrician in New Zealand must hold a current practising licence from the Electrical Workers Registration Board. Always ask to see it.
- Local experience — An electrician who knows Hastings well will understand local council requirements and common wiring setups in older homes around the Bay.
- Insurance cover — Make sure they have public liability insurance. This protects you if something goes wrong during the job.
- Clear communication — A good tradie will explain what needs doing, why it needs doing, and how much it'll cost before they start.
- References or reviews — Check online reviews or ask for references from recent local jobs. Word of mouth goes a long way in a place like Hastings.

Key Questions to Ask Before Hiring
Before you commit to anyone, have these questions ready. They'll help you sort the pros from the amateurs:
- "Are you a registered electrical worker with the EWRB?"
- "Can you provide a fixed-price quote before starting the work?"
- "What's your availability like, and how long will the job take?"
- "Do you handle the necessary paperwork for council consent if needed?"
- "What warranty do you offer on your workmanship?"
Don't be shy about asking these. A trustworthy electrician will be happy to answer them clearly and without hesitation.
Tips for Getting the Best Results
Want your electrical project to run smoothly? Follow these simple tips:
- Plan ahead — Think about what you really need. Extra power points? Outdoor lighting? Knowing this upfront saves time and back-and-forth.
- Get everything in writing — A written quote and scope of work prevents misunderstandings later on.
- Be home for the job — If possible, be around to answer questions as they come up. It makes the whole process faster.
- Trust the professional — If your electrician advises against something for safety reasons, listen. They're looking out for you.
- Check the final work — Before you pay, make sure everything's working as it should. Test switches, lights, and outlets.
A Note About Costs and Getting Quotes
Electrical work in Hastings typically ranges from around $80 to $130 per hour for a licensed electrician, plus the cost of materials. But prices can vary depending on the job's complexity and how urgent it is.
Your best bet is to get at least three quotes from different electricians. This gives you a good sense of what's fair and helps you spot anyone who's way over or under the market rate. Just remember — the cheapest quote isn't always the best choice. Quality and safety should come first.
